The heart of the 5721 beats with the caliber 26-330 S QA LU 24H, a testament to Patek Philippe's dedication to in-house movements. This self-winding mechanical marvel is a masterpiece of engineering, showcasing the brand's commitment to pushing the boundaries of horological innovation. The "QA" designation signifies the presence of a perpetual calendar, a complication that automatically adjusts for the varying lengths of months and leap years, eliminating the need for manual adjustments for decades to come. The "LU" indicates the presence of a moon phase display, adding a touch of celestial elegance to the already impressive functionality. The "24H" signifies a 24-hour display, often found as a subsidiary dial, providing a clear indication of the time, even in low-light conditions.
